Transaction 23f93248a282c4e76b19d1d8c7233e75c3e446acd9c7576d3590c3c5a4e0243b

1 Input
2 Outputs
  • 23f93248a282c4e76b19d1d8c7233e75c3e446acd9c7576d3590c3c5a4e0243b:0
  • value  36123019
    address  1PYYsgi8xuhogGw4AvMujmzG3EwY9gwX2f
  • 23f93248a282c4e76b19d1d8c7233e75c3e446acd9c7576d3590c3c5a4e0243b:1
  • value  3857213
    address  18ZF52RFHjWHpenFnu5vQRKsqesvsW7HDC